Output 17cb70552689fe38f0581f1c68df0447be2bbe5d1ead3e0c5298afa68c32e34d:1

value
128529768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245d45187b7cf82b7bf7b24f11d8e0aa3c081bfe OP_EQUAL
address
351HyxR4tQW4NmCN5Y8M1JV3yjBkAZroZB
transaction
17cb70552689fe38f0581f1c68df0447be2bbe5d1ead3e0c5298afa68c32e34d
spent
true